Tips for how to file a problem report

Here are some things to consider when filing a problem report:

Please file your report as soon as possible after you find a problem. The
sooner we hear from you, the sooner we can investigate and try to fix the
problem.

Please provide a brief, descriptive title. The title is the first thing we
see when we get the report, so a succinct, clear title will help us
effectively identify and prioritize the problem.

Please provide enough detail in the description for us to understand the
problem. The more detail you can provide, the better.

Please provide the steps we can follow to reproduce the problem. Any
incorrect or missing steps can prevent us from being able to reproduce and
address the problem.
If you have any supplemental files, screen shots, etc., that will help us
investigate the problem, please attach those to your report. Seeing a
picture can sometimes help us identify the problem more quickly.
